Examples

  • 2 atmosphere technical [at] equals 19,613,300 centipascal [cPa].
  • 0.5 atmosphere technical [at] equals 4,903,325 centipascal [cPa].

Frequently Asked Questions

What is an atmosphere technical (at)?
Atmosphere technical (at) is a non-SI pressure unit defined as one kilogram-force per square centimetre, equal to 98,066.5 pascals.

Why convert atmosphere technical to centipascal?
Conversion helps translate legacy pressure values into SI-derived units for modern low-pressure measurement and sensor calibration.

Can atmosphere technical be confused with standard atmosphere?
Yes, because atmosphere technical differs from standard atmosphere, indicating units clearly is important to avoid confusion.

Key Terminology

Atmosphere Technical (at)
A pressure unit equal to one kilogram-force per square centimetre, approximately 98,066.5 pascals, used in older technical and engineering contexts.
Centipascal (cPa)
An SI-derived unit of pressure equal to one hundredth of a pascal, used to express very small pressure values.
Kilogram-force per square centimetre
A unit of pressure corresponding to the force of one kilogram-force applied over an area of one square centimetre.
